This agreement (the “Agreement”) is entered into by and between the following parties (the “Parties”) as of the 31st day of July, 2006: (i) Xxxxx X. Xxxxxx (“Xx. Xxxxxx”) and (ii) DHB Industries, Inc. (the “Company” or “DHB”).
RECITALS
WHEREAS, on July 1, 2000, the Company and Xx. Xxxxxx entered into a five-year employment agreement (the “Employment Agreement”) entitling Xx. Xxxxxx to, among other things, (i) 750,000 warrants exercisable at $1.00 per share vesting every year on the anniversary of the Employment Agreement and (ii) the right to extend the Employment Agreement for an additional five-year term on the same terms and conditions; and
WHEREAS, on December 27, 2004, Xx. Xxxxxx exercised his right to extend the Employment Agreement for an additional five-year term on the same terms and conditions;
WHEREAS, Xx. Xxxxxx became entitled on July 1, 2006 to exercise warrants to acquire 750,000 shares of common stock of DHB at $1.00 per share and provided notice of his exercise of those warrants on July 7, 2006 (the “July Warrants”);
WHEREAS, Xx. Xxxxxx remained in possession of unvested and unexercised warrants to acquire 3,000,000 shares of common stock of DHB at $1.00 per share (the “Unvested Warrants”);
WHEREAS, on July 12, 2006, the Parties, among others, entered a Memorandum of Understanding (“MOU”) in settlement (the “Settlement”) of the matters captioned (i) In re DHB Industries, Inc. Class Action Litigation, United States District Court for the Eastern District of New York, No. CV 05-4296 (JS) (ETB) and (ii) In re DHB Industries, Inc. Derivative Litigation, United States District Court for the Eastern District of New York, CV 05-4345 (JS) (ETB) (collectively, the “Litigation”);
WHEREAS, DHB agreed in the Memorandum of Understanding to accelerate the vesting of the Unvested Warrants and Xx. Xxxxxx agreed to exercise those warrants at an increased exercise price of $2.50 per share in order to fund, in part, the Settlement and in consideration of Xx. Xxxxxx’ resignation from his positions at DHB;
WHEREAS, The Memorandum of Understanding provides that, in the event the Settlement is not finally approved by the Court in substantially the form of, and containing substantially the same provisions as those set forth in, the Memorandum of Understanding, DHB shall pay or cause to be paid from the settlement funds being held in escrow, to Xx. Xxxxxx, $4,500,000, being the difference between the warrant exercise price of $1 per share and the elevated exercise price of $2.50 per share, multiplied by the 3,000,000 shares involved.
AGREEMENT
NOW, THEREFORE, the Parties agree as follows:
1. | Xx. Xxxxxx shall immediately resign from the Board of Directors and all other positions at the Company. |
2. | Xx. Xxxxxx shall immediately pay the Company $8,250,000 (plus any withholding taxes, as instructed by the Company, due as a result of the exercise of the Unvested Warrants at $2.50 a share and the July Warrants at $1.00 a share), $7,500,000 of which shall be directly deposited by Xx. Xxxxxx into the escrow account (the “Escrow Account”) established pursuant to the Escrow Agreement executed simultaneously herewith; |
3. | Any withholding tax so instructed by the Company shall be determined in good faith based on calculating the fair market value of the Unvested Warrants and the July Warrants using the volume weighted average price of the Company’s Common Stock on July 6, 2006 for the July Warrants and July 28, 2006 for the Unvested Warrants; |
4. | The Company shall immediately issue to Xx. Xxxxxx 3,750,000 shares of its duly issued and authorized common stock in respect of the July Warrants and the Unvested Warrants; |
5. | In the event the Settlement is not finally approved by the Court in materially the form of, and containing materially the same terms as those set forth in, the Memorandum of Understanding, the Company shall pay or cause to be paid from the Escrow Account to Xx. Xxxxxx, within 10 days after Court’s failure finally to approve the settlement as aforesaid, $4,500,000, being the difference between the exercise price of $1 per share applicable to the Unvested Warrants and the increased exercise price of $2.50 per share, multiplied by the 3,000,000 shares involved. The Company’s obligations under this Section 5 shall be contingent upon the return of settlement funds from the Escrow Account. In the event that amounts from the Escrow Account are not released to the Company within 10 days after Court’s failure finally to approve the settlement as aforesaid, the Company shall cause $4,500,000 to be paid to the Xx. Xxxxxx directly from the Escrow Account as soon as the funds are permitted to be released from the Escrow Account. |
6. | The Company shall have no further obligations and Xx. Xxxxxx shall have no further rights under any warrant or option agreements between the Parties (including without limitation in respect of the July Warrants, the Unvested Warrants and any other warrants granted to Xx. Xxxxxx under the Employment Agreement), with the sole exception of warrants or options previously granted to Xx. Xxxxxx on the same terms and conditions as other directors as compensation for service on the Board of Directors of the Company (which warrants and/or options shall remain valid and enforceable). |
7. | Xx. Xxxxxx hereby confirms and acknowledges his obligations to file Forms 4 and an amendment to Schedule 13D as required by the Securities Exchange Act of 1934, as amended. |
